Dhulikhel Municipality submits SDGs report to UN



KATHMANDU: Dhulikhel Municipality has submitted the Sustainable Development Goals Report, 2022 to the United Nations.

The report mentions its achievement of four goals of the 17 SDGs.

The municipality in April published a report mentioning its achievement of four foals of the SDGs in education, health, poverty alleviation and safe drinking water.

Municipality Mayor Ashok Byanju on Monday submitted the report to Curt Garrigan, Chief of the Sustainable Urban Development Section at a function at the UN to the UN Office in Thailand.

“I submit the report under the SDGs. It is a matter of pride,” he said.
